Sewer Pipe Clearing in Kansas City, MO
Sewer pipe clearing services involve removing blockages and buildup within underground sewer lines to restore proper flow and prevent backups. This service typically covers residential projects such as clearing clogged main lines, drain pipes, or lateral connections that may be causing slow drains, foul odors, or sewage backups. Property owners should understand the common causes of blockages, including grease buildup, debris, tree roots, or accumulated scale, and recognize when professional clearing is necessary to maintain a healthy and functional plumbing system.
Before requesting sewer pipe clearing, homeowners often want to know about the methods used, such as hydro jetting or mechanical augering, and what to expect during the process. It’s also helpful to understand the importance of identifying the location and extent of the blockage to determine the most effective approach. Clear communication about the scope of work and any potential disruptions can assist property owners in planning accordingly to ensure a smooth and successful service experience.

Common Sewer Pipe Clearing Jobs
Sewer pipe clearing - removes blockages to restore proper flow in residential drainage systems.
Clog removal services - clears obstructions caused by debris, grease, or tree roots in sewer lines.
Drain cleaning - uses specialized tools to eliminate buildup and prevent future backups.
Pipe snaking - employs augers to break through stubborn clogs deep within sewer lines.
Hydro jetting - utilizes high-pressure water to thoroughly clean and clear sewer pipes.

Sewer Pipe Clearing Questions
What causes sewer pipes to clog? Common causes include debris buildup, grease, hair, and tree root intrusion, which can block flow and lead to backups.
How can I tell if my sewer pipe is blocked? Signs include slow drains, gurgling sounds, foul odors, or sewage backups in fixtures.
What types of projects typically require sewer pipe clearing? Projects often involve resolving persistent clogs, restoring flow after backups, or preparing for plumbing repairs.
Is sewer pipe clearing a messy process? It involves removing obstructions from pipes, which may produce some debris or water, but professionals manage cleanup effectively.
